Block

#18,593,657
Block Number
18,593,657 @ 05/23/2024, 11:40:10
Status
Finalized
ID
0x011bb779651c95eec04bcf328fc3bde5a910bf943246045073417c74c1622670
Transactions
Gas Used
57518/40000000 (0.14% Used)
Total Score
1,812,091,138 (+96)
Rewards
0.17 VTHO